Filming begins for the second season of 'Poquita fe' (Movistar Plus+)
'Poquita fe', one of the biggest hits of last season, begins filming its second season in various locations in Madrid.
Produced by Buendía Estudios for Movistar Plus+, Little faith will once again transfer in a humorous key the day-to-day life of the couple starring Raúl Cimas and Esperanza Pedreño. Using the techniques of mockumentary, the series will try to consolidate itself again as a phenomenon of critics and audiences, reissuing the awards it already won as best comedy series in the Ondas Awards y los Feroz Awards.
Created by Pepón Montero and Juan Maidagán, and directed by Montero himself, the series once again has its great cast of supporting actors: Julia de Castro, Marta Fernández Muro, Chani Martín, María Jesús Hoyos, Juan Lombardero, Pilar Gómez and Enrique Martínez, among others. Carles Gusi He will act as director of photography, accompanied by the art direction of Matteo Mariotti and the sound of Pedro R. Soto. In the post-production room, Pastor Map and Marta Nebot will be in charge of assembling the Eight episodes of fifteen minutes that will make up this new season.
This is the synopsis of the second season of Little faith: "It's been three months. With the couple's crisis still to be resolved, Berta and José Ramón are kicked out of the flat. After a lot of searching, one of the neighborhood offers them a flat next to the one they had for a small price, but for six months he is not free. They decide to wait and, during that time, go live with their in-laws. One day the sister-in-law arrives, who has also been left homeless and who settles there with them. Living with the family, whether in-laws or their own, is a litmus test for any couple. And Berta and José Ramón, as we have already seen, are not the most prepared to pass acid tests. We'll see how it ends."
